Thursday, 10 December 2015

The Seihos

It is time to post a band from the city where I am from, Barcelona. 
The Seihos is a band formed in Barcelona and, for those who like Vampire Weekend, I am sure this band is for you. This year they published their third album "Farewell", with the same vibes as the first one.

We cannot find so much on Youtube, but only their "single" that came first to the people because of a TV ad. However, I invite you to listen to his albums on Spotify or other platforms, and enjoy!

Monday, 7 December 2015

Iron & Wine

Let's continue with a folk band called "Iron & Wine", that is the artistic name for Sam Beam, an American singer-songwritter.

"Waitin' for a Superman" is one of the huge amount of good songs he has, so I invite you to listen to him deeply.
